a reason why you can move around a bit more freely here at the christmas market lived i don't necessarily feel secure because of the police i think. accidents like this make it more it's more of a thing where people become more united was. christmas markets terror attack 3 years ago today. on friday u.s. aircraft maker boeing is due to launch of starliner astronaut capsule along its 1st unmanned journey to the international space station if successful the spacecraft will free nasa from reliance on russian bickles to travel to the r s s but the project it has been dogged by technical ability a rival spacecraft built by space x. completed its test flight last more. heavy duty

rocket is set to launch the starliner into space for its test flight and deposit it 180 kilometers above the earth's surface. from there the space capsule equipped with its own measurement sensors and thrusters is supposed to fly to the i access international space station and dock with it completely automatically. a few days later the starliner will decouple from the eye assess and part with that service module in order to return to earth. the unpiloted capsule should then safely and gently land on the ground in new mexico but the help of parachutes and airbags if all goes to plan the starliner will soon be able to transport astronauts into space.

the space shuttles were once readied for lift off in this hangar for the past few years it's where the starliner has been built. a man transport system for the next generation nasa is having it developed and built by boeing a private company. the starliner resembles the apollo spacecraft which once landed astronauts on the moon. its crew capsule can be reused after the fly. right it should complete 10 missions in total and carry up to 7 astronauts into space at a time. the crew will be seated an upper and lower rows when they lift off for their missions. at the beginning of november the starliner completed a simulated takeoff emergency a security system had to transport the manned capsule out of the danger zone the
